Susie Carlino gained her degree in textiles design in 1991. After working
for a short while in the textile industry she found herself working for
a lighting company in London.
This was a perfect introduction to the effects of special effect lighting
giving a great insight into what materials work best with each application.
Working along side one of the best lighting guys in the business, Gerry
Calderhead (Future Projects) they would come up with basic ideas, which
together would develop and translate into numerous looks and designs.
Susie and Gerry have always bounced ideas off each other and are continuing
to experiment with new shapes in lighting and textures. This is exemplified
at the annual Southport Weekender, where for 16 years they have strived
to out do themeselves at every event.
From the beginning Susie realised how drapes alone can look good but together
with the right type of lighting the combination can really create magic.
Professionalism
At Creative Draping we pride ourselves on our professionalism and commitment
to a safe working practice. All our crew have ladder awareness and only use professional
ladders. All our crew have PASMA certificates on tower safety and IPAF certificates
on mobile elevating work platforms as standard. A Method Statement can be carried
out on request along with a Risk Assessment on any job. We have enough Public
Liability to cover us to work anywhere. All materials used are Flame Retardant
and certified to British Standards and can be supplied on request.
Creativity
It´s not just a case of trying to give a client what they think they
want, but more a case of expanding their options by exploring
the possibility of what can be achieved within the time scale, venue and budget
stretch imaginatively. Having a complete understanding of production and lighting,
Susie is able to redefine draping like no-one else. One of her concepts is to
use invisible draping. By using fine netting in various ways she can create multi-dimensional
shapes that are brought to life when illuminated by lighting effects. By using
this concept you can create an amazing atmosphere of patterned light.
She has a flare for the abstract and thinks of her work as installations
creating shape and atmosphere. Recently Susie has been experimenting
a lot with organza fabrics to build modern, clean, sharp environments
but at the same
time capturing the softness that comes with the use of such a diaphanous
fabric.
